IVC March In This Years London Pride
The theme for this year was #PrideJubilee, honouring 50 years of activism, protests and victories that have made the movement what it is today.
All over the country, during June and July this year, Pride flags were flown and parades took place to continue to fight for equality and to challenge prejudice.
IVC were honoured to sponsor the BVLGBT+ march in this year’s London Pride. Amelia Reynolds practice manager at Boness Vets attended to march alongside the BVLGBT+ and to show IVC’s support for the LGBT+ community.
‘It was a privilege and honour to march with BVLGBT+, an amazing group of people. I was proud to represent my community, my profession and my company.
She went on to say,
“Marching in pride isn’t about you, it’s about those who haven’t made it that far yet. It’s about taking stock of all that has been achieved and how far the LGBT+ community has come but also how far there still is to go. It’s about being inspired and inspiring others. Above all else it is about love and equality.”
IVC has joined the fight and promises to:
- Continue promoting their passion for equality and diversity within IVC and the veterinary industry
- Become a recognised LGBT+ employer
- Give support to the LGBT+ community within the company
